Background
In clinical diagnosis or treatment, the reagent is often required to be delivered into the rectum through the anus, and the medicament is absorbed through the rectum to exert curative effect, or is deposited on the inner wall of the intestinal tract to realize development and improve the imaging effect. The former is such as common enema and the latter is such as common contrast agent and other detection reagent.
In current conventional technical scheme, adopt the flexible bag splendid attire reagent that has the intubate usually, the bag is spherical or oval or water droplet shape, extrudees the utricule behind inserting the intubate anus and injects reagent into the rectum, but reagent has a lot of to stay and causes the waste, and the intubate is hard straight tube usually, uses the operation inconvenience by oneself, needs other people to assist. At present, the technical scheme that the syringe is additionally provided with the insertion tube is adopted, but the self-operation is still difficult because the pudendum is difficult to observe, the insertion tube is usually positioned in the middle of the syringe, even if the insertion tube is assisted by other people, the syringe barrel can also block the sight, and the insertion depth is inconvenient to observe and difficult to perceive during the insertion.
Therefore, in the field of medical devices, there is a need for an anal reagent delivery device that can be operated by the patient and is easy to observe and thoroughly discharged.

Detailed Description
Referring to fig. 1 to 5, this embodiment shows an anus reagent feeding device, which includes a reagent tube 1 with an opening at one end, a plane where a tube bottom of the reagent tube 1 and the opening of the reagent tube 1 are located is inclined, a reflection area 7 is disposed on an outer surface of the tube bottom of the reagent tube 1, an output nozzle 2 is disposed at a position farthest from the opening at the tube bottom, a delivery tube 3 capable of being inserted into an anus to guide a reagent is disposed at the output nozzle 2, and a pushing assembly capable of pushing out the reagent is disposed at one end of the opening of the reagent tube 1. It can be understood that, unlike the prior art, the reagent cartridge 1 is generally a cylinder with two flush ends and one open end, the present invention has the cartridge bottom inclined and the reflection area arranged on the surface outside, so that the private part of the patient can be observed through the reflection area, the insertion position and the insertion depth can be known, and the cartridge body of the reagent cartridge 1 does not interfere with the sight. It should be noted that the inclined arrangement of the bottom of the reagent cartridge means that the bottom of the reagent cartridge is inclined to the plane of the opening of the reagent cartridge 1 or is not in a normal perpendicular relationship with the axis of the reagent cartridge 1, and the inclined angle of the bottom of the reagent cartridge can be changed as appropriate according to the use situation, such as being arranged at 60 degrees more vertical or 30 degrees more horizontal, but is usually arranged at 45 degrees to obtain the maximum observation visual field. Conveyer pipe 3 can be integrated mechanism with output mouth 2, reagent section of thick bamboo 1, plays convenient to use's effect, also can adopt conveyer pipe 3 and output mouth 2 can dismantle the form of being connected, plays the benefit of being convenient for accomodate the packing.
In addition, the whole proportion of the reagent cylinder 1 is different from that of a conventional slender injection cylinder, the reagent cylinder 1 is flat and thick, so that the pushing distance is greatly shortened, a patient can conveniently realize one-hand operation, the other hand can be used for holding the lower limbs to avoid shaking or holding other supports to keep the balance of the body, the operation time can be shortened after the pushing distance is shortened, the patient is prevented from keeping an uncomfortable posture for a long time, and the reagent feeding process is ended as soon as possible. The specific size of the reagent cartridge 1 such as the volume can be reasonably changed according to the age, physical condition, medication requirement and drug type of a patient, for example, the volume for injecting the enema is usually 10-20ml, the dosage can be properly increased if the condition is serious or the wall of the anal tube and intestine is dry, meanwhile, the volume of the reagent cartridge 1 is correspondingly increased, for example, the volume of the contrast agent is usually 15-50ml, the specific selection amount is determined by a doctor according to the size of a focus, and then the reagent cartridge with the proper volume is selected according to the dosage.
Furthermore, the bottom of the reagent cylinder 1 is concave curved surface. The reflective area 7 is provided with a reflective film or coating. It can be understood that the concave curved surface has amplification effect, so that people who bend over a limited range and have a long distance or have poor eyesight can clearly observe the condition of the pudendum.
Further, conveyer pipe 3 is including being close to the upwarp section 31 of output mouth 2, upwarps section 31 and toward being close to 1 axis direction bending of reagent section of thick bamboo, upwarps section 31 and keeps away from the one end of output mouth 2 and is equipped with down bent section 32, and down bent section 32 extends toward keeping away from 1 axis direction of reagent section of thick bamboo, upwarps section 31 and down bent section 32 smooth transition. The cross-sectional area of the downturned section 32 decreases with increasing distance from the spout 2. It can be understood that, when preparing to insert or just inserting, if set up to the straight tube then can because the inconvenient observation of far away reflection formation of image, set up to upwarp section 31 and connect down the curved section 32 time, if the patient uses by oneself, can conveniently observe through angular adjustment, if other people assist, the plane of reflection is towards human back, 3 ends of conveyer pipe are farther with 1 distance of reagent section of thick bamboo, observe and operate and get up more clearly and distinguish, it is more convenient when the front end of conveyer pipe 3 is more carefully inserted, also can reduce patient's uncomfortable and feel.
Furthermore, a plurality of shunting holes 33 are formed in the side wall of the end of the downward bending section 32, and the shunting holes 33 are uniformly distributed in the circumferential direction. The plurality of shunting holes are uniformly distributed in the circumferential direction of the end head of the downward bending section 32, and it can be understood that the middle single hole arrangement has many defects, for example, the middle part of the end head is easy to be blocked, for example, a large amount of reagent can be sprayed in the middle part of a cavity channel, and the defects can be avoided by arranging the shunting holes 33 in the circumferential direction, and the reagent can be uniformly sprayed to the anal canal or the rectal wall.
Further, the propelling movement subassembly includes piston 4 with 1 inside wall interference fit of reagent section of thick bamboo, 4 inboard terminal surfaces of piston and the bobbin base adaptation of reagent section of thick bamboo 1, and 4 outside terminal surface middle parts of piston are equipped with push rod 5, and push rod 5 stretches to 1 outside of reagent section of thick bamboo and is connected with push tray 6. Furthermore, two ends of the push rod 5 are provided with push rod seats, and the sectional area of each push rod seat is larger than that of the push rod 5. It can be understood that the bottom of the reagent tube 1 is a concave curved surface, and the inner side surface of the piston 4 is matched with the bottom of the reagent tube, so that the inner side surface of the piston 4 is also a concave curved surface, and the arrangement can ensure that the piston 4 can be completely attached to the bottom of the reagent tube when being pushed to the foremost end by the push rod 5 and the push disk 6, thereby ensuring that the reagent can be completely discharged.
Further, the delivery pipe 3 is provided with a scale for indicating the insertion depth. It will be appreciated that the provision of a scale on the delivery tube 3 may facilitate the user or facilitator to know the depth of insertion of the delivery tube 3 and to stop it as required. In order to facilitate use and avoid damage caused by over-deep insertion, the length of the delivery pipe 3 can be made into different specifications with various lengths so as to meet different requirements, the specific length is changed according to the depth of an acting part, the age and the shape of a using object and the like, for example, when the reagent is injected into an anal canal part, the length of the delivery pipe 3 is usually 3-6CM, when the reagent acts on a rectum part, the length of the delivery pipe 3 is usually 5-8CM, for example, the length of the delivery pipe 3 suitable for infants at the same application position is shorter than that of adults, so the specific numerical value can be reasonably selected according to requirements in implementation.
Referring to fig. 1, 4 and 5, there is shown a method of using the anal reagent delivery device of the present invention. When the delivery pipe 3 is inserted, the pushing assembly is rotated to enable the far end of the piston 4 to abut against the near end of the barrel bottom, so that reagent leakage caused by touching the pushing disc 6 before and during insertion is avoided, the pushing assembly can be rotated to the position, corresponding to the barrel bottom, of the piston 4 after the piston is inserted to a proper depth, the pushing plate 6 is continuously pushed to enable the reagent to be delivered into an anal canal or rectum, the insertion depth can be increased while the pushing plate 6 is pushed to enable the reagent to be dispersed along the anal canal or the rectum until the end face of the inner side of the piston 4 is attached to the barrel bottom, and the reagent delivery process is completed. Of course, if the operation is skilled or assisted by others, the first step can be omitted, and the push plate 6 is directly pushed at the position of the piston 4 corresponding to the bottom of the cylinder until the whole reagent feeding process is completed.
